mirror of
https://github.com/penpot/penpot.git
synced 2026-05-18 06:23:49 +00:00
11 lines
193 B
Clojure
11 lines
193 B
Clojure
(ns uxbox.util.syntax
|
|
(:refer-clojure :exclude [defonce]))
|
|
|
|
(defmacro define-once
|
|
[& body]
|
|
(let [sym (gensym "uxbox-")]
|
|
`(cljs.core/defonce ~sym
|
|
(do ~@body
|
|
nil))))
|
|
|